Is Your Early Childhood Program Struggling With How To Enjoy Holidays In A Respectful, Antibias Way? Now You Can Let The Celebrating Begin! Celebrate! Is The Comprehensive Resource To Guide You Through The Sensitive Issues Surrounding Holidays. It Is Filled With Strategies For Implementing Exciting Culturally And Developmentally Appropriate Holiday Activities So You Can Party With Ease. Chapters Include Developing A Holiday Policy, Selecting Holidays, Addressing Stereotypes And Commercialism, Evaluating Holiday Activities, And More. Celebrate! Tells You How To Involve Families And Get On The Road To Making Holidays Something That Everyone Looks Forward To Celebrating!Includes A Preface By Louise Dermansparks.
